## Archive cold buckets

Moves Norvane cold-storage buckets older than the retention cutoff into the glacier tier. Runs nightly; safe to pause mid-batch. On-call: if throttling alarms fire, lower the batch size and rerun — the job is idempotent. Deletion is never performed here, only tiering. Tuning constants used by the archiver are as follows.

constants for tageg-kagag:
QUOTAS = {
    "kelax": 495,
    "istath": 366,
    "tammir": 108,
    "novdor": 730,
    "casax": 816,
    "quenael": 874,
    "pelius": 403,
}

**Mgmt Meeting Minutes — Retiring the Brightline Range**

Quick recap for sales leads at Fenholt Supplies: we agreed to retire the Brightline fixture range by year-end. Remaining stock moves to clearance pricing next month, and accounts on standing orders get migrated to the Lumetta range. Trade-in incentives were approved in principle. The confidential note on next steps sits just below.

board note of bajof-bajeg: The pricing group signed off on a budget of $13.4 million for Project Sildor. The renewal with Lamixek Holdings closes at $48.9 million a year, 49 percent above the last contract.

Finance Review — Franchise Agreement Summary

The franchise agreement between Calloway Grains and regional operator Tindervale Holdings was reviewed this quarter. Royalty payments are current, marketing contributions are on schedule, and the territory expansion clause remains unexercised. Renewal falls due in fourteen months, and terms are expected to tighten. Branch managers should factor the following confidential note on our plans into local forecasting.

confidential, kagep-kahof: Druokax Systems plans to lower the Ulaath list price by 53 percent in March.